登录
首页 » Matlab » GA BinPacking MATLAB

GA BinPacking MATLAB

于 2022-03-25 发布 文件大小:16.51 kB
0 113
下载积分: 2 下载次数: 2

代码说明:

装箱问题 在装箱问题,对象不同的卷必须挤进有限数量的桶或容器每个的第五卷中将使用的回收箱的数目降至最低的方式。在计算复杂性理论,它是一个组合的 NP 难问题。 还有很多变化的这个问题,如 2D 包装、 线性包装,包装的重量、 包装成本,等等。他们有许多应用程序,例如填满的容器,载货汽车与重量的能力制约,在可移动媒体和现场可编程门阵列半导体芯片设计中的技术映射创建文件备份。 装箱问题也可以被视为下料问题的一个特殊情况。当回收箱的数目只限于 1 和每个项目描绘为一个卷和一个值时,可以适合在箱子里的物品价值最大化的问题被称为背包问题。 尽管装箱问题有 NP 难的计算复杂性,以复杂的算法可生产非常大量的实例问题的最优解。此外,已制定了很多启发式算法: 例如,第一个适合的算法中,提供一个快速但往往非最优解决方案,涉及将每个项放入第一次的 bin 在其中它会适合。它需要 Θ (n) 的时间,其中 n 是要将打包的元素数。通过第一次排序到递减顺序排列 (有时称为第一合适降低算法),虽然这仍然不能保证最佳的解决方案,但和更长的列表的元素的列表可能会增加运行时间的算法,可以作算法有效得多。然而,众所周知总是存在至少一个排序的项目,允许第一个适合以产生最佳的解决方案。[] 1 装箱在实践中出现的一个有趣的变形时,项目可以共享空间,当挤进垃圾桶。具体来说,一组项可以占用较少空间时挤在一起比其个体大小的总和。这个变形被称为 VM 包装 [2],因为当虚拟机 (Vm) 包装在服务器中,其总的内存需求可能减少由只需要一次存储的虚拟机共享的页面。如果项目可以以任意方式共享空间,装箱问题很难甚至近似。但是,如果作为分享到层次结构中,适合的空间是在虚拟机中共享内存的情况,装箱问题可以高效地接近。

下载说明:请别用迅雷下载,失败请重下,重下不扣分!

发表评论

0 个回复

  • gradient
    本程序实现了基于梯度金字塔的图像融合算法,效果还不错,可以参考一下。(This procedure based on the gradient pyramid implementation of image fusion algorithms, the effect was not bad, you can reference.)
    2009-03-25 16:38:54下载
    积分:1
  • matlab6.5
    《matlab6.5辅助图像处理》源代码()
    2008-04-03 12:17:08下载
    积分:1
  • matlab-Kmeans
    利用matlab实现kmeans聚类算法的简单实现代码(matlab kmens algrithom )
    2012-03-26 08:59:53下载
    积分:1
  • Fuzzy-Calculus-Core-
    这是有关模糊集的知识,里面有一些MATLAB仿真代码,希望对大家有帮助(This is the fuzzy set of knowledge, there are a number of MATLAB simulation code, we want to help)
    2011-05-12 10:08:41下载
    积分:1
  • Monte-Carlo
    蒙特卡洛方法,用于数学建模过程中的蒙特卡洛算法的上机运行(monte carlo )
    2012-07-09 11:05:59下载
    积分:1
  • Sort_pyramid
    Pyramid sort, for 9-elements array (just for main idea)
    2013-11-12 05:27:24下载
    积分:1
  • elm
    极限学习机源代码 黄广斌 南洋理工大学循序渐进,让新手学会如何matlab编程(Extreme Learning Machine source code Huangguang Bin Nanyang Technological University, step by step, so that novices learn how matlab programming)
    2014-05-27 22:10:05下载
    积分:1
  • 全面的计算加权加速度,matlab源码
    MIT人工智能实验室的目标识别的源码,能量谱分析计算,基于多相结构的信道化接收机,利用matlab针对图像进行马氏距离计算 ,计算互信息非常有用的一组程序,music高阶谱分析算法。
    2022-06-11 16:56:37下载
    积分:1
  • Modelling_systems_linear_objects_some_systems
    STEP: 1.Bringing descriptive model matemaryczny dyiiamike obiektii issue. 2.Present the resulting model in the form of transmittance merging appropriate input and output size. 3. Move the resulting model as rownaii state. 4. By making use of differential equations that describe rowname dyiiamike obiektii modeled. build a model in srodowiskn MATLAB / Simulink. 5.Przy carry out a model built using the experiments indicated by conducting classes and graphs to present position and speed of the system elements. 6. Discuss the correctness of obtained in the course s> wyiiikow stimulations.
    2010-12-05 00:51:41下载
    积分:1
  • fuzzy-control
    基于MATLAB的模糊控制,清华大学出版社的某一章节,带程序(Fuzzy control based on MATLAB, a section of tsinghua university press, with the program)
    2014-07-03 13:20:32下载
    积分:1
  • 696516资源总数
  • 106459会员总数
  • 0今日下载